Here are some tips to recover reset or deleted accounts.

According to several Pokemon Go players, the newest update has reset or deleted their Pokemon Go account completely.

Here is how players can recover their deleted accounts.

Right Gmail Account

The Pokemon Go update updated the Google Account login system. It means that when players begin or log into the game, they may mistakenly generate a new account under a different Google email address.

It can happen if users sign in via the Safari browser or an iOS device. If this happens, players should sign out of their account and after that open the game again.

They should select the Google login method, and check the email address in the top right corner of the page. Gamers should ensure that it is the same one they used when they initially created their account.

Players can uninstall and reinstall Pokemon Go if this does not work. Also, according to some Reddit users, people have to catch the starter first, and then go to settings and log out.  It will be fixed when they log back in. Players should log in with the correct account.

Here are some other fixes

Players should ensure that their login says @gmail if they are a Google user. They should keep logging out and logging back in. One Reddit user said that their email account was not switched; however, they kept coming up with a wiped account.

The user only logged out and logged in with the correct account, over and over, till it ultimately worked.
Players should try removing the game's permissions from their Google account settings.

They should sign into Google on their browser and then go to Settings and select Look for Apps that have access to my account. They should find Pokemon Go and remove its permissions. Then, they should reinstall the app and sign in with the right email.

Gamers can also remove all saved Google passwords in their settings. To do this, they should go to settings > General > Passwords > Select any Google.com accounts > edit > delete.

Meanwhile, according to a Forbes report, the footprints feature has been entirely removed from the game in the recent update. The footprints were removed due to a glitch that was causing each creature to appear to be three footsteps away. Niantic Labs has decided to remove the feature completely till they can work out a solution.
